The Era of AI-powered Trading

The shift towards AI-driven trading is steadily gaining momentum. Thanks to AI-powered analytics and machine learning models, traders  are now in a better position to identify patterns, predict market trends, and optimize trading strategies with precision. Algorithmic trading, in particular, is redefining execution by automating trade orders based on intricate mathematical models, reducing latency, and enhancing liquidity.

Advertisment

SEBI has emphasised on the difference in performance between individual traders and institutional players like FPIs, who leverage algorithmic trading for consistent profits. Therefore, advancements in AI-driven algorithms are empowering individual traders, offering a level-playing field to the F&O segment and enabling them to make more informed and data-driven decisions.

The market trends also capture the technological progress. The global algorithmic trading market valued at $15.55 billion in 2021 is projected to grow at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 12.2% between 2022 and 2030. The projection underlies the  growing reliance on AI-driven strategies. This evolution is gaining pace in India as well. As per a recent report by the Association of National Exchanges Members of India (ANMI), 83.6% of stockbrokers planned to increase their IT budgets in 2024-252 to integrate AI and algorithmic trading into their operations. The goal is to enhance both efficiency and customer engagement.

Revolutionizing Customer Experience

Advertisment

To both retail and institutional traders, AI-driven digital broking offers a range of features such as personalised trading recommendations, predictive analytics, and automated portfolio rebalancing. These features ensure that trades can make informed decisions easily.

By leveraging processed customer data from Machine Learning models, AI is gradually becoming hyper personal, providing personalised alerts to the traders based on their search and investment behaviours. Additions such as advanced-data infrastructure, customer behavioural models, real-time analysis, customer behavioural models, etc. will become integral parts of the AI-driven customer experience.

How AI is shaping the future of trading

Advertisment

As we move forward, we are entering a phase where behavioural intelligence will redefine how traders will interact with the markets. AI is poised to revolutionize broking by tapping into investor psychology.  AI can help in detecting cognitive biases like loss aversion or recency bias. This bias has long been driving irrational decisions like panic selling during downturns. AI instead  instantly analyzes the trading behaviour and intervenes of a trader and guides her/him with real-time, data-driven suggestions.

This isn’t just about smarter stock picks. It is about creating emotional intelligence in the trading journey. AI will fine-tune the portfolio to align it with the emotional comfort and risk tolerance of the trader so that she/he does not lose sight of the long-term goals, no matter how volatile the market becomes. Market herding and panic-driven moves will eventually reduce with the advent of AI. AI will pave the way for building a more stable and confident trader base. The new-age tools will help traders make rational, informed decisions. AI will reshape the broking industry, creating a stronger, more resilient stock market that will attract and empower traders and grow.
